## What it is

If you already run Traffic Dominator, connect your account and NexoFlow registers every post you publish as a campaign- with the keywords derived from the post itself- then reports the numbers back in one place.

This is an integration, not a NexoFlow service. Traffic Dominator runs the campaigns; NexoFlow does the paperwork - registering each published URL, deriving its keywords, and pulling the metrics back so you are not reconciling two dashboards by hand.

your Traffic Dominator account · your keys · your spend

## Connect, choose channels, publish

1. Connect your own account- Paste your Traffic Dominator API key. It's stored encrypted, it stays yours, and NexoFlow acts only as a client of their API.
2. Choose which channels count- Pick per project which destinations register a campaign. Every channel you switch on is real spend on your Traffic Dominator bill.
3. Publish as normal- When a post goes live, its URL, derived keywords, and country are registered. Metrics then appear alongside the post in NexoFlow.

## It spends money, so it asks first

Every enabled channel creates a paid campaign on your Traffic Dominator account. The defaults are built around that.

- Your key, encrypted- You bring your own Traffic Dominator account. The API key is stored encrypted and used only to call their API on your behalf.
- Google Business is off by default- GBP campaigns start disabled, because switching them on for existing customers would have quietly created paid campaigns nobody asked for.
- Unknown channels never spend- A destination nobody has explicitly decided about does not register a campaign just because it happened to publish.
- Per-channel, not all-or-nothing- Website, Google Business, and each social network are separate switches you control per project.
- Deleted campaigns are visible- If a campaign is removed on the Traffic Dominator side, NexoFlow says so plainly rather than showing stale numbers as if it were live.
- You can stop tracking anytime- Stop a campaign from NexoFlow, or disconnect the account entirely. Publishing carries on unaffected.

What this is, stated plainly: Traffic Dominator is a third-party traffic and click-through service. NexoFlow registers your published URLs with it and reports the results; their servers do the actual work. We make no claim that this improves your search rankings or Google visibility, and it is not part of the SEO Brain- that works from your real Search Console data and is a separate thing entirely. Treat this page as distribution and reporting plumbing for a tool you have already chosen to use.

## Common questions

Do I need a Traffic Dominator account? Yes. This is an integration with a third-party service you subscribe to separately. Without your own account and API key there is nothing to connect.

Does this improve my Google rankings? We make no such claim. Traffic Dominator is a third-party traffic and click-through service, and NexoFlow's role is limited to registering your published URLs and reporting the numbers back. If you want to work on search performance, that's the SEO Brain, which reads your real Search Console data and is completely separate from this.

Will connecting it start spending money? Enabling a channel means published posts on that channel register paid campaigns on your Traffic Dominator account. Website and social channels default on and Google Business defaults off, specifically so switching this on doesn't silently create campaigns you didn't choose. Review the channel switches per project before you publish.

Where does the keyword list come from? By default it's derived from the post and its project, since the website campaign type requires keywords and a country. You can supply your own list instead.

What if I delete a campaign in Traffic Dominator? NexoFlow shows it as no longer existing there and stops presenting its metrics as live, rather than displaying stale numbers. You can then clear it on the NexoFlow side.

Can I turn it off? Yes. Disable individual channels, stop individual campaigns, or disconnect the account. None of it affects your normal publishing.
